Safety Information
- This chair has a maximum weight capacity of 650 lbs. Do not exceed this limit.
- Ensure the chair is properly assembled for optimal stability. Regularly check all screws and connections for tightness.
- Lift and move the chair with care, as it weighs approximately 62 lbs. Seek assistance if necessary.
- The quiet rubber wheels are designed to protect your floors. Avoid using the chair on uneven surfaces or over obstacles that could damage the wheels or cause instability.
- Keep hands and clothing clear of moving parts during adjustment.
- Do not stand on the chair.

Setup and Assembly
Assembly is required. Please follow the steps below carefully. It is recommended to assemble the chair on a soft, clean surface to prevent damage.
- Attach Casters to Base: Insert the casters into the holes at the end of each leg of the star base. Push firmly until they click into place.

- Insert Gas Lift: Place the gas lift cylinder into the center hole of the assembled star base.

- Attach Mechanism Plate to Seat: Align the mechanism plate with the screw holes on the underside of the seat cushion. Secure it with the provided screws, ensuring the front of the mechanism faces the front of the seat.

- Attach Armrests to Seat: Secure the armrests to the sides of the seat cushion using the designated screws. Pay attention to the 'L' (Left) and 'R' (Right) markings.

- Attach Backrest to Seat and Armrests: Align the backrest with the mounting points on the seat and armrests. Secure with screws. Ensure all connections are tight.

- Place Assembled Seat onto Gas Lift: Carefully place the assembled seat (with backrest and armrests) onto the gas lift cylinder. The tapered end of the gas lift should fit securely into the mechanism plate.

Operating Instructions
Chair Adjustments
- Seat Height Adjustment: Locate the lever on the right side beneath the seat. To raise the seat, lift the lever while taking your weight off the chair. To lower the seat, lift the lever while seated. Release the lever to lock the height.
- Rocking Function and Recline Lock: The chair features a 125° rocking function. Pull the lever on the left side beneath the seat outwards to enable rocking. Push it inwards to lock the chair in an upright position. The tilt tension knob, located beneath the seat at the front, can be rotated to adjust the resistance of the rocking motion.

- 5D Armrests: The armrests offer multiple adjustment options:
- Height Adjustment: Press the button on the side of the armrest and move it up or down.
- Forward/Backward Slide: Slide the armrest pad forward or backward.
- Pivot: Rotate the armrest pad 360° to find your preferred angle.
- Flip-up: The armrests can be flipped up 90° to allow the chair to be pushed closer to a desk or for easier entry/exit.

- Adjustable Lumbar Support: The chair features adjustable lumbar support to ease back pressure. Adjust the lumbar support to your desired position for optimal comfort.
Massage and Heating Function
The chair is equipped with a 4-point vibrating massage system and a heating function for the lumbar area. Use the provided remote control to operate these features.
- Power On/Off: Connect the chair's power adapter to a wall outlet. Use the 'POWER' button on the remote to turn the massage and heating functions on or off.
- Massage Modes: Select from 2 massage modes using the 'MODE' button.
- Massage Position Selection: Use the remote to select specific massage points.
- Heating Function: Activate the heating function with the 'HEAT' button. The lumbar area can warm up to 130°F.
- Timer: Set a timer for the massage function using the remote control.

Maintenance
- Cleaning: The chair's leather finish requires dry cleaning. For general cleaning, wipe surfaces with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
- Hardware Check: Periodically check all screws and bolts to ensure they are tight. Loose hardware can affect the chair's stability and safety.
- Caster Care: Keep the wheels free of hair and debris to ensure smooth movement and prevent floor scratches.
- Gas Lift: Do not attempt to disassemble or repair the gas lift cylinder. If it malfunctions, contact customer support for replacement.
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Chair is wobbly or unstable | Loose screws or improper assembly. | Check all assembly screws and tighten them securely. Ensure the gas lift is fully seated in the base and mechanism. |
| Seat height does not adjust | Gas lift cylinder malfunction or lever issue. | Ensure the height adjustment lever is fully engaged. If the gas lift is faulty, contact customer support for a replacement. |
| Chair does not rock or recline | Recline lock engaged or tilt tension too tight. | Pull the recline lock lever outwards to enable rocking. Loosen the tilt tension knob by rotating it counter-clockwise. |
| Casters (wheels) are not rolling smoothly | Debris caught in casters or worn-out wheels. | Remove any hair or debris from the caster wheels. If wheels are worn, replacements are readily available and can be installed by pulling out the old ones and pushing in new ones. |
| Massage/Heating function not working | Power connection issue or remote control battery. | Ensure the power adapter is securely connected to the chair and a working power outlet. Check the remote control for battery issues. |
